About Bass Fishing Game - Lake Masters
Bass Fishing Game - Lake Masters is a fishing simulation title that was released for the PlayStation in the late 1990s. This game falls within the sports genre and provides players with a unique experience centered around the art of fishing. While details about the developer are not widely documented, the game has gained a cult following among fans of retro gaming and fishing enthusiasts alike.
In Bass Fishing Game - Lake Masters, players engage in various fishing challenges, using different techniques and equipment to catch various species of fish. The gameplay typically involves selecting fishing spots, choosing bait, and timing your casts to reel in the biggest catches. The game aims to simulate a realistic fishing experience, which includes factors like weather conditions and water depth that can affect fishing success.
